萬盛學電腦網

 萬盛學電腦網 >> Solaris介紹 >> Solaris設置ADSL撥號上網

Solaris設置ADSL撥號上網

一、系統基本設置 # touch /etc/ppp/pppoe.if 重啟系統後會創建撥號相關的文件 # touch /etc/gateways 重啟後會添加IP路由功能 # touch /etc/hostname.hme1 重啟後會添加上第二塊網卡,該網卡如果已經添加,那麼可省

一、系統基本設置

# touch /etc/ppp/pppoe.if        

重啟系統後會創建撥號相關的文件

# touch /etc/gateways                

重啟後會添加IP路由功能

# touch /etc/hostname.hme1        

重啟後會添加上第二塊網卡,該網卡如果已經添加,那麼可省去此步。通過ifconfig -a可以查看該網卡是否啟用。該網卡hme1是和adsl modem相連的網卡。

# echo "nameserver 202.96.134.133"  >; /etc/resolv.conf        

添加上離你最近的DNS服務器,重啟生效,可以在此文件中添加多個DNS server。

# cp /etc/nsswitch.dns /etc/nsswitch.conf        

此步驟的目的是修改/etc/nsswitch.conf,當然直接改動/etc/nsswitch.conf。

二、PPPOE基本設置

確認系統中已經安裝上如下的軟件:

SUNWpppd - Solaris PPP Device Drivers
SUNWpppdr - Solaris PPP configuration files
SUNWpppdt - Solaris PPP Tunneling
SUNWpppdu - Solaris PPP daemon and utilities
SUNWpppdx - Solaris PPP 64-bit (ONLY needed for SPARC's with 64-bit kernels)
 

如果沒有,那麼從solaris的第二張安裝光盤盤中進行補裝。有兩個ppp的大軟件包,選上即可。

# reboot -- -r

重新進入系統之後,going on.......

# ls /dev | grep ppp           確認存在sppp和sppptun
# grep sppp /etc/name_to_major
sppp 146
sppptun 147 

編輯撥號配置文件

# vi /etc/ppp/peers/bohao        添加如下幾行
sppptun
plugin pppoe.so
connect "/usr/lib/inet/pppoec hme1"        #hme1是與MODEM相連的網卡
persist                                        #自動重播
user "USERNAME"                                # username
noauth
noipdefault
noccp
novj
noaccomp
nopcomp
defaultroute

存盤退出由於你的ISP需要對你進行密碼驗證,所以你還要編輯一下密碼文件,但是ISP可能用到的文件是/etc/ppp/chap-secrets和/etc/ppp/pap-secrets 因此分別要到這兩個文件中的最後一行中追加: username * password 我要提醒的是:上行中的字段之間是TAB鍵分割的,而不是空格。到此為止,配置已經結束了,接下來就是撥號。綁定網卡

# sppptun plumb pppoed hme1
# sppptun plumb pppoe hme1
# sppptun query        檢查是否綁定成功
# /usr/lib/inet/pppoec -i hme1 探測與hme1相連的ISP網卡的MAC地址信息,主要是確保物理線路是否存在問題。
# /usr/bin/pppd call bohao   bohao為/etc/ppp/peers的一個撥號配置文件。
# ifconfig -a                驗證是否出現sppp0的網口,如果網絡不暢,此處可能需要等一段時間。

可以把上述的操作簡單的寫成一個教本,開機自動執行。

# vi /etc/rc2.d/S48bohao        添加如下幾行
sppptun plumb pppoed hme1
sppptun plumb pppoe hme1
/usr/bin/pppd call bohao

存盤退出

# chmod u+x /etc/rc2.d/S48bohao

到此,服務器的撥號設置告一段落。

copyright © 萬盛學電腦網 all rights reserved